Posted

If you want to create RAID-5 you will have to use all of your 3 HDDs.

If you have created a RAID with 2 HDDs (and left 1 HDD) it will be RAID-0 or RAID-1.

That`s not what you wanted - but you did it...

There is no way to change your 2-HDD-RAID to RAID-5 (with 3 HDDs).

It`s still unclear how you create your RAID.

I´m used to create my RAID in the BIOS - no drivers or OS is needed.
